Our Mission

The Alice West Fleet counseling department supports the mission of Arlington County Public Schools and the mission of Alice West Fleet. The mission of Fleet’s counseling program is to provide a comprehensive, equitable and multicultural program to foster a culture of respect and success for all students. We assist students in acquiring the mindsets and behaviors that contribute to effective learning in school and the ability to adapt to an ever-changing society. Our program provides equitable access so all our students experience success and strive towards achieving their personal best. Counseling department interventions support the development of self-confidence, conflict resolution skills, emotional regulation, responsible citizenship, self- advocacy, self-expression and self-control within a culture of respect and high expectations for all. Our annually evaluated and data-driven program enables all students to experience success and become positive members of a school community they experience as safe and welcoming.

Our Philosophy

Alice West Fleet Elementary School believes the school counseling program is an integral part of successfully supporting the education and development of the whole child. Fleet’s comprehensive counseling program is based on the belief that academic, career, and personal/social development can be enhanced for all students through participation in counseling activities. The counselor collaborates with staff to implement program services and achieve the counseling department’s mission. Counseling initiatives are developmentally appropriate and support students through suitable sequences of learning.

Alice West Fleet Elementary’s School Counseling Program will provide:

  • A comprehensive school counseling program that supports diverse needs and advocates for the best interest of every student
  • A data-driven, results-oriented and collaborative approach to service/program delivery
  • Programs from the counseling department that are evaluated for program effectiveness through various assessments (completed by students, staff, and parents)
  • A full-time counselor devoted to efficient and productive program implementation: classroom guidance, small group work, individual counseling support, consultation, and program coordination
  • Specific focus on preventing, identifying, and intervening early for at risk students

All school counselors will:

  • Abide by the ethical responsibilities of the Commonwealth of Virginia, Arlington Public Schools, and the American School Counselor Association
  • Conduct themselves in a professional manner and participate in professional development to maintain a high quality counseling program
